A straightforward, no-nonsense guide to streamlining expenseswithout sacrificing valuable programs and services.
Even in a good national economy, nonprofit organizations can havetight financial constraints. And since most nonprofits are alreadyoperating close to the fiscal balance line, they feel the financialpinch sooner and more acutely than business or government when theeconomy takes a downward spin.
This nuts-and-bolts resource will help you find ways to:
--Effectively balance your budget
--Minimize spending through thirty general money-saving principlesand opportunities
--Maximize your organization's various assets
--Save money on personnel costs without firing anyone
--Reduce office equipment and supply costs
--Negotiate the best possible price with vendors--Develop long- andshort-term strategies for expense reduction
--Create an action plan as well as a cost-saving team
The money-saving tips that Gregory Dabel presents in this usefulguide will benefit even those organizations whose revenues arethriving. Saving Money in Nonprofit Organizations is forprofessionals who are ready to take action and improve theirfinancial bottom lines.
About the Author
GREGORY J. DABEL is head of the nonprofit consulting firmStewardship Services. He frequently presents at workshops andconferences across the country sponsored by The National Alliancefor Nonprofit Management (formerly known as Support Centers ofAmerica), the Christian Management Association, and others. Dabelis also an international correspondent for WORLD magazine and acolumnist for the Sonoma West Times & News.
